Transnomino

A batch rename utility for the Mac. Rename many files at once, simple, powerful... subtitle

  • Bulk renamer tool to prepare images for website upload / file name sanitizer
    You could try Transnomino. I've used it before and it's very good. You can save a set of transformations as a template and use it next time you need it. Source: over 1 year ago
